<h2> What Is a Cable Management Device and Why Is It Important? </h2> <a href="https://www.aliexpress.com/item/1005002529860382.html" style="text-decoration: none; color: inherit;"> <img src="https://ae-pic-a1.aliexpress-media.com/kf/Hcb2f1a2a33164f129eb167bbfc721458P.jpg" alt="Smart Cable Holder Silicone Flexible Cable Winder Wire Organizer Holder Cord Management Clip for USB Earphone Network Cable" style="display: block; margin: 0 auto;"> <p style="text-align: center; margin-top: 8px; font-size: 14px; color: #666;"> Click the image to view the product </p> </a> The cable management device is a tool or system designed to organize and secure cables, preventing them from becoming tangled, damaged, or unsightly. It is especially useful in environments where multiple cables are used, such as home offices, entertainment centers, and tech workstations. A cable management device can be as simple as a clip or as complex as a modular system with built-in cable ties and mounting options. Answer: A cable management device is essential for keeping your space tidy, reducing the risk of tripping, and improving the efficiency of your tech setup. Key Benefits of a Cable Management Device: Keeps cables organized and easy to access Prevents tripping hazards Protects cables from damage Enhances the overall aesthetics of your space How to Choose the Right Cable Management Device: When selecting a cable management device, consider the following factors: <ol> <li> Size and capacity: How many cables will you need to manage? </li> <li> Material: Is it durable and suitable for your environment? </li> <li> Mounting options: Does it stick to surfaces, or does it require screws? </li> <li> Flexibility: Can it be adjusted to fit different cable types and lengths? </li> </ol> Comparison of Common Cable Management Devices: <style> .table-container width: 100%; overflow-x: auto; -webkit-overflow-scrolling: touch; margin: 16px 0; .spec-table border-collapse: collapse; width: 100%; min-width: 400px; margin: 0; .spec-table th, .spec-table td border: 1px solid #ccc; padding: 12px 10px; text-align: left; -webkit-text-size-adjust: 100%; text-size-adjust: 100%; .spec-table th background-color: #f9f9f9; font-weight: bold; white-space: nowrap; @media (max-width: 768px) .spec-table th, .spec-table td font-size: 15px; line-height: 1.4; padding: 14px 12px; </style> <div class="table-container"> <table class="spec-table"> <thead> <tr> <th> Device Type </th> <th> Pros </th> <th> Cons </th> </tr> </thead> <tbody> <tr> <td> Cable Clips </td> <td> Simple and affordable </td> <td> Not suitable for large cable bundles </td> </tr> <tr> <td> Cable Winder </td> <td> Flexible and easy to use </td> <td> May not hold well on vertical surfaces </td> </tr> <tr> <td> Wire Organizer Box </td> <td> Provides storage and protection </td> <td> Less portable and more expensive </td> </tr> </tbody> </table> </div> <h2> How Can a Cable Management Device Help in a Home Office Setup? </h2> <a href="https://www.aliexpress.com/item/1005002529860382.html" style="text-decoration: none; color: inherit;"> <img src="https://ae-pic-a1.aliexpress-media.com/kf/H49615463c40c4dbda262f9daa4fe41355.jpg" alt="Smart Cable Holder Silicone Flexible Cable Winder Wire Organizer Holder Cord Management Clip for USB Earphone Network Cable" style="display: block; margin: 0 auto;"> <p style="text-align: center; margin-top: 8px; font-size: 14px; color: #666;"> Click the image to view the product </p> </a> In my home office, I have multiple devices connected to my desk: a monitor, a laptop, a printer, a router, and several USB devices. Steps to Use a Cable Management Device in a Home Office: <ol> <li> Identify all the cables you need to manage: monitor, keyboard, mouse, printer, router, etc. </li> <li> Choose a suitable cable management device based on the number and type of cables you have. </li> <li> Mount the device on a flat or vertical surface, such as the desk or wall. </li> <li> Secure each cable using the device’s clips, hooks, or winding mechanism. </li> <li> Label the cables if necessary for easy identification. </li> </ol> Best Practices for Using a Cable Management Device in a Home Office: Use a cable winder for longer cables like USB or network cables. Use cable clips for shorter cables like mouse and keyboard cords. Avoid overloading the device with too many cables at once. Regularly check and adjust the cables to ensure they remain secure and organized. My Experience: I used a Smart Cable Holder that came with a flexible cable winder and wire organizer clips. It was easy to install and worked well for most of my cables. However, I found that the adhesive base didn’t hold very well on vertical surfaces, so I had to use additional double-sided tape to keep it in place.
